Conditions for Transportation and Storage

•  Temperature: Between 40 - 1000F (5 - 400C)

•  Relative Humidity: 30% to 70%, non-condensing

•  Always keep the projection screen horizontal during transport 

and storage

•  Make sure the entire package is supported when stored

•  Do not stack more than six projection screens on top of each other

•  Make sure the heaviest package is places at the bottom of the stack

Screen surface should be allowed to air out once every two months, or otherwise used on a regular basis, if the temperature is above 
720F  (220C) and at least once every month if the temperature goes above 850F (300C).
